If your uPVC window doesn't close properly, it may be because of an indentation between the frame and the sash. This could not only cause draughts, it could also cause damp and water damage. You can test it by putting a piece paper between the sash frame and the sash, to see whether the sash is shut.

To fix the issue, you'll need to take off the seals surrounding the frame and the sash. Then, you'll have to remove the gearbox that locks from its position inside the frame. To access the gearbox you will require a flat screwdriver or torch. After you have removed the gearbox, you will need to replace it with a brand new one that is the same model and size.

UPVC window frame repair

If your uPVC windows have cracks, holes, or damaged window seals It is crucial to repair them right away. These problems could cause the glass of your windows to become cloudy and could also cause water leaks. In addition, the frame damage can reduce the insulation value of your home, which can result in higher energy bills. Most of these issues are easily fixed by an expert or a DIY repair.

UPVC window repair is more cost-effective than replacing the entire window, however there are instances when it is better to replace the entire unit. This is especially true when the frame has been damaged beyond repair. There are a variety of factors that affect the total cost of UPVC window replacement, including material type and the amount of work involved. A complete replacement could cost between $100 and $1000 per window. The price will differ based on the severity of the damage and whether or not a new installation is needed.

Cleaning UPVC windows is essential to avoid moisture and dirt buildup. You will avoid expensive repairs in the future. You should do this at least once each year. You could also use WD-40 to grease the moving parts on your UPVC windows. Before cleaning the frame, it is recommended to remove any dust or cobwebs with a soft bristle brush. You can sand off any scuffs on the frames in order to make them appear brand new.
